the price of elasticity of demand for tvs in canada is 1.2 andthe income elasticity of demand for automobiles is 3. What would the effect of a 3 percent decline in tv prices onthe quantity of tvs demanded. What would be the effect of a 2 percent increase inincome? Some help please. Thank you so much in advance...Explanation / Answer
Elasticity of Demand= %Change in Quantity demand /%ChangePrice 1.2= x/3%=3.6% increase in quantity demand for TV Income Elasticity= %change in Quantity Demand / % change inincome 3= %change in quantity demand / +2% = 6% increase in demandfor TVRelated Questions
